> There are SPI instructions at doc/board/rockchip but they are pretty
> 'one way'. So you would need a way to get your old SPI-flash contents
> back when it doesn't work, because I don't think these platforms
> support SD boot. I use a 'servo' board and a Dediprog em100 SPI
> emulator. I know that kevin does not support CCD (Close-Case
> Debugging) so you cannot program the SPI flash that way...

The doc/board/rockchip instructions are slightly outdated in that they
don't mention u-boot.rom, it's enough just to flash that whichever way
possible. There's also the additional prerequisite of disabling
write-protection, which I tried to explain a bit in that wiki as well.

I can usually flash things from U-Boot/Linux, but when I flash a bad
build I do have to use my CH341A + 1.8V adapter to recover from it.

I don't know if booting from an SD card is outright impossible on these
boards, but current config doesn't even have the devices enabled in SPL,
and I couldn't get it to work with my naive blind attempts.
